Code: 13068Start date: 14/03/2014Time: 1.30 - 4.30pmDuration: 10 weeksCampus: Station PlazaFee: £155

Explore different ceramic techniques and create your own pottery. You will learn hand-building methods, mould making, casting and throwing on electric wheels. Glazes are applied through spraying, painting or ceramic transfers.

AAT Level 2 Certificate in Computerised Accounting (Saturday)Code: 9840Start date: 29/03/2014Time: 9am - 2pmDuration: 6 weeksCampus: Ore ValleyFee: £125

The software used in this course is Sage. This allows users to input and process data for orders, receipts, invoices, payments and preparing management and period-end reports.

Awareness Training: Asbestos

Code: 15010Start date: Roll on roll offTime: VariousDuration: ½ dayCampus: TBCFee: £75

This training is for anyone who may come into contact with asbestos during their everyday work. You will learn how to identify asbestos and where it is used, the effects of Asbestos, how to avoid the risks from asbestos and what you must do if asbestos is exposed.

Makaton

Code: 13036Start date: 13/01/2014Time: 7 - 9pmDuration: 6 weeksCampus: Station PlazaFee: £90

The Makaton vocabulary uses signs and symbols to support the spoken language. It is designed to help adults and children who have language and learningdifficultiestocommunicate.This course will introduce you to the basic Makaton vocabulary required to express ideas. It is ideal for parents, family members, carers and workers.
